#8 Wrestling finishes regular season with 18-13 upset of #6 Pitt

Submitted by Wolverine Devotee on

The #8 ranked Wolverines concluded a stellar regular season tonight with an 18-13 dual win over #6 Pittsburgh on the road. The grapplers finish with an 11-4 overall record and 6-2 in the B1G.

Results-

  1. 125- #15 Connor Youtsey (Michigan) def. #19 Anthony Zanetta (Pitt) via sudden victory 1, 5-3
  2. 133- #19 Rosario Bruno (Michigan) def. #20 Shelton Mack (Pitt) by decision, 6-1
  3. 141- #8 Steve Dutton III (Michigan) def. #17 Edgar Bright (Pitt) by decision, 6-1
  4. 149- #8 Eric Grajales (Michigan) def. Mike Racciato (Pitt) by decision, 8-5
  5. 157- #14 Brian Murphy (MIchigan) def. Cole Sheptock (Pitt) by decision, 6-0
  6. 165- Geno Morelli (Pitt) def. #6 Dan Yates (Michigan) by decision, 3-1
  7. 174- #7 Tyler Wilps (Pitt) def. Collin Zeerip (Michigan) by major decision, 19-8
  8. 184- #6 Max Thomusseit (Pitt) def. #16 Domenic Abounader (Michigan) by decision, 2-0
  9. 197- #18 Nick Bonaccorsi (Pitt) def. Chris Heald (Michigan) by decision, 8-2
  10. Heavyweight- #2 Adam Coon (Michigan) def. #19 P.J. Tasser by decision, 9-6

Michigan faced 10 ranked opponents this season and went 7-3 against them including 3-2 against top-10 opponents.

With the regular season wrapped up, Michigan will now prepare for the B1G Championships which will be held March 8th & 9th in Madison.

The NCAA Championships will be held March 20-22 in Oklahoma City
